Output c37076574c8aa3f5db2c13c0d94369b9a59aafcecc97ad4744a262f9080a3ca5:19

value
868465
script pubkey
OP_0 OP_PUSHBYTES_32 d8c90013b5902f359c9aedc5a2aef1b14e8f2e27328afe4918e01d4858a0b841
address
bc1qmrysqya4jqhnt8y6ahz69th3k98g7t38x290ujgcuqw5sk9qhpqszlzmcu
transaction
c37076574c8aa3f5db2c13c0d94369b9a59aafcecc97ad4744a262f9080a3ca5
spent
true